aboutsummaryrefslogtreecommitdiffstats
path: root/R/lossdistrib.c
diff options
context:
space:
mode:
Diffstat (limited to 'R/lossdistrib.c')
-rw-r--r--R/lossdistrib.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/R/lossdistrib.c b/R/lossdistrib.c
index 0a2c30ab..a2984e6b 100644
--- a/R/lossdistrib.c
+++ b/R/lossdistrib.c
@@ -19,7 +19,7 @@ void lossdistrib_blas(double *p, int *np, double *w, double *S, int *N, int *def
double shockprob(double p, double rho, double Z, int give_log);
void lossdistrib_Z(double *p, int *np, double *w, double *S, int *N, int *defaultflag,
- double *rho, double *Z, double *wZ, int *nZ, double *q);
+ double *rho, double *Z, int *nZ, double *q);
void lossdistrib_truncated(double *p, int *np, double *w, double *S, int *N,
int *T, int *defaultflag, double *q);
@@ -66,6 +66,7 @@ void lossdistrib(double *p, int *np, double *w, double *S, int *N, int *defaultf
the loss distribution.
p vector of default probabilities
np length of p
+ w issuer weights
S vector of severities (should be same length as p)
N number of ticks in the grid
defaultflat if true compute the default distribution
@@ -113,6 +114,7 @@ void lossdistrib_blas(double *p, int *np, double *w, double *S, int *N, int *def
the loss distribution.
p vector of default probabilities
np length of p
+ w issuer weights
S vector of severities (should be same length as p)
N number of ticks in the grid
defaultflat if true compute the default distribution
@@ -157,7 +159,7 @@ void lossdistrib_blas(double *p, int *np, double *w, double *S, int *N, int *def
}
void lossdistrib_Z(double *p, int *np, double *w, double *S, int *N, int *defaultflag,
- double *rho, double *Z, double *wZ, int *nZ, double *q){
+ double *rho, double *Z, int *nZ, double *q){
int i, j;
double* pshocked = malloc(sizeof(double) * (*np) * (*nZ));